Leveraging Dependency Injection Modules

Dependency injection modules are a fundamental concept in software development, promoting modularity and testability. By encapsulating the creation and management of dependencies within dedicated modules, developers can achieve loose coupling between components, streamlining code maintenance and facilitating unit testing. Mastering this technique involves understanding module structure, dependency resolution strategies, and best practices for organizing your application's dependencies.

Effective dependency injection modules leverage containerization frameworks to simplify dependency management. These containers offer features like automatic registration of dependencies, lifecycle management, and scope resolution, reducing boilerplate code and enhancing maintainability. To truly master this powerful paradigm, explore different container implementations, experiment with various dependency resolution strategies, and adopt robust testing practices to ensure the robustness and reliability of your application's architecture.
